Course Details
• Principles of Sustainable Plumbing: Understanding the core concepts of sustainable plumbing systems, their benefits, and the importance of retrofitting.
• Assessing Current Plumbing Systems: Identifying the components of existing plumbing systems, evaluating their efficiency, and determining the potential for retrofitting.
• Water Conservation Techniques: Exploring water-saving devices and techniques, such as low-flow fixtures, rainwater harvesting, and greywater recycling.
• Energy-efficient Appliances and Equipment: Examining energy-saving technologies in plumbing, including tankless water heaters, solar water heating, and efficient pumps.
• Sustainable Materials and Resources: Identifying eco-friendly materials and resources used in sustainable plumbing systems and their benefits.
• Designing Sustainable Plumbing Systems: Learning the principles of designing sustainable plumbing systems, including layout, sizing, and material selection.
• Installation, Maintenance, and Repair: Practicing the installation, maintenance, and repair of sustainable plumbing systems, focusing on best practices and troubleshooting.
• Regulations and Compliance: Understanding the legal and regulatory requirements for retrofitting sustainable plumbing systems, including building codes, permits, and certifications.
• Case Studies and Real-world Applications: Analyzing successful sustainable plumbing retrofits, identifying key factors for success, and applying lessons learned to future projects.
